The powerful, athletic 6’5 junior wingman recently made his debut with Whitney M. Young Magnet High School’s team (MaxPreps preseason #7 in the Nation) in Chicago. Here is your first (and only) look!
Ranked among the top 60 players in his class nationally, Peak led Gaffney (South Carolina) to a 4A state championship game in March. The all-state and all-region selection was the Indians’ leading scorer with 17.5 points and averaged 4.3 rebounds and 3.5 assists per game.
Peak has offers from Ohio State, Florida State, Marquette, Georgetown, Memphis, Virginia Tech, Wake Forest, NC State, DePaul, Illinois, South Carolina and Clemson.
Playing a national schedule with Chicago powerhouse Whitney Young alongside top juniors 6’11 Jahlil Okafor and 6’9 Paul White, Peak figures to attract plenty of interest and Ballislife.com will be there.
